About the role

  • Set Product Vision: Co-create and review with PM and Sr PM, the vision of the product. Analyze KPI's for measures of success and provide recommendations to Sr PM.
  • Develop Roadmap: Develop and determine course of action for roadmap based off of reporting and metrics and work closely with Sr PM. Analyze KPI's for measures of success.
  • Gather Requirements: Understand and evaluate the problem state and work with key partners on existing approaches to resolve issues.
  • Define the product & stakeholdering: Responsible for low complex products and product features and analyze and recommend based on metrics. Strengthen relationships with business partners and knowledge share as needed.
  • Design Partnership: Partner with design to ensure cohesive future state user visions and experiences are aligned.
  • Author User Stories: Translate requirements to technical details to build and validate use cases and user stories around a product and communicate them effectively.
  • Data & Customer Research: Inform product decisions with both qualitative and quantitative data on behavior and experimentation.
  • Feature Prioritization: Develop and maintain a prioritized backlog of user stories for implementation according to business value or ROI.
  • Facilitate ceremonies: Participate in and sometimes facilitate the daily Scrums, Sprint Planning Meetings and Sprint Reviews and Retrospectives.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's Degree.
  • 2-4 Years of prior experience with at least 2 working in a Product Management role.
  • Knowledge Preferred: formal business analyst, engineering or testing experience, knowledge of the financial services industry, familiar with BI tools, knowledgeable expertise or experience with Scrum Framework.
  • Must have demonstrated cross functional work in previous experience along with strong communication skills, time management, project management skills, business acumen, and high self-awareness/EQ.
  • Previous experience with research, analysis, and providing recommendations.
  • Ability to translate product requirements into technical requirements and work in ambiguity and solutioning.
  • Ability to analyze and navigate through complex problems; exercise judgment based on the analysis of multiple sources of information.
